Description

Explore the military origins of modern Israel through this intense historical study by J. Bowyer Bell. Based on the philosophy of Menachim Begin, "We fight, therefore we are," this book examines the motivations behind the violent struggle for a sovereign Jewish homeland. This work analyzes the actions of the Irgun, Lehi (the Stern Gang), and the Zionist underground during the era of British mandated Palestine. It provides a deep look at how these groups operated against the British forces, Arab populations, and even their own less violent counterparts to achieve their goals. Readers gain a detailed understanding of the underground movements that shaped the foundation of the state.
